    Modern students have clear goals and high expectations, says Ian Matthias. Higher education institutions face fiercely competing priorities. They’re under pressure to rank highly in measures such as the teaching excellence framework (TEF), but at the same time students are more discerning than ever about what they expect from university. A recent survey of UK vice chancellors by PA Consulting found that 59 per cent felt that maximising TEF ratings was a top strategic priority, while 79 per cent prioritised student satisfaction over league table rankings. And now that National Student Survey ratings are likely to carry less weight in TEF ratings, the goalposts are changing all the time. 

    伊恩∙马蒂亚斯说,现代学生有明确的目标和较高的期望。高等教育机构面临着诸多需要优先处理的事项,而它们的重要性不分伯仲。高等教育机构为了在“教学卓越框架”(the teaching excellence framework, 简称TEF)等测评中取得更好的排名而备受压力,而同时,学生们也比以往更清楚自己期望从大学里得到什么。近期,博安咨询集团(PA Consulting)对英国各个大学的副校长进行了调查。调查显示,他们中的59%认为充分利用TEF评级是策略上的最佳选择,而79%将学生对于名次表中排名的满意度作为优先考虑的事项。另外,由于全国学生调查(National Student Survey)评级在TEF评级中的重要性有下降的趋势,所以规则是一直在改变的。

    What is certain is that today’s students are making decisions on higher education armed with far more information than previous generations, and seek greater certainty about what their university can offer them in terms of scholarship, employability, student experience and pastoral care. This shift towards more student-centric universities is one that has been happening for some time, albeit slowly, says Ian Matthias, higher education consultant at PA Consulting. PA Consulting describes this new relationship as ‘Student 4.0’ – students have clearer goals and higher expectations of the type of relationship they will develop with a university in order to achieve their ambitions.   

    毋庸置疑,当今的学生比上一代掌握着更多信息,供他们在高等教育上做出选择,他们也更清楚大学能给他们提供怎样的奖学金、就业率、学生经历和人文关怀。博安咨询公司的高级教育顾问伊恩∙马蒂亚斯说,尽管速度缓慢,但大学朝向学生为中心的转变已持续一些时日。博雅咨询公司将这种新的关系称为“学生4.0”, 即学生在发展与大学的关系时,拥有更明确的目标和更高的期望,以便实现自己的理想。

    “Universities are now far more demand-led,” Matthias explains. “They’re trying to find and communicate their value proposition -- how they’re relevant to students’ lives, but realising at the same time that they can’t be all things to everyone.” Institutions are at different stages of this transition, he adds, and the most advanced are adapting large parts of their business models to become more student-centric.

    马蒂亚斯解释说:“大学越来越以需求为导向,它们试图寻找并传达自己的价值主张——它们怎样与学生的生命息息相关,但同时也意识到自己不能满足所有人。”他补充道:“不同的机构正处于不同的转型阶段,最先进的大学正在更大程度地把自己向以学生为中心的的商业模式转变。

    A good example of this is Coventry University’s Add+vantage Scheme, which enables students to gain work experience and career development activities alongside their studies rather than as a separate element.

    考文垂大学的“Add+vantage”计划就是一个很好的例子,这一计划将工作经历和职业发展活动纳入学生的学习之中,而不是让它们与教学相孤立。

    Northampton is an example of a university that has recognised its value proposition is in offering something unique, becoming the ‘go-to’ institution for those who want to work in or set up social enterprises.

    北安普顿大学在价值主张的确立中做出了表率。它将自己的价值确立为提供独一无二经历的,从而成为了有志于建立或服务于社会企业的学生“必去”的机构。

    A key part of developing that value proposition is realising that a university cannot meet every demand of every type of student, Matthias points out. “All too often, in the scramble for growth, looking for the best-fit students becomes a secondary consideration, and their experience falls short of what they were expecting,” he says.

    马蒂亚斯指出,发展价值主张的一个关键点在于,要意识到一所大学不能满足所有类型的学生的所有需求。通常,在生源的争夺中,寻找最合适的学生退居次要考虑因素,而且学生的经历会达不到他们的预期水准。

    教学卓越框架(the teaching excellence framework,简称TEF)是英国政府自2016年发起的,用来激励大学和高等教育机构优化教学质量的评分机制。大学和高等教育机构可以自主选择是否参加评分,TEF会根据教学质量、教学环境、学生成就等指标,把学校分为金、银、铜等不同级别。教学质量TEF分析目前主要适用于本科教学,致力于帮助学生选择更合适的大学,并提高学生对于学校教学的满意度。
